⚜️ The Story of Joan of Arc ⚜️ She was born in Domrémy-la-Pucelle in 1412 to a peasant family. At the age of 13, she began hearing voices telling her to save France from the English. She left her village to seek help from King Charles VII and reclaim the French throne. Joan of Arc successfully convinced King Charles VII to grant her an army. She led this army to several victories against the English, including the liberation of Orléans in 1429. This victory marked a turning point in the Hundred Years' War and led to the defeat of the English. Joan of Arc was captured by the English in 1430. She was tried and burned at the stake in 1431 in Rouen. However, her popularity continued to grow after her death. She was canonized by the Catholic Church in 1920.

The Basilica of Bois-Chenu (Roman Catholic) is a gigantic monument in Domremy-La-Pucelle. It is also called the Basilica of Sainte Joan of Arc. It is located about 11 km from Neufchâteau on an idyllic hill in the Vosges Mountains. From this wooded hill, you can enjoy a magnificent view of the Meuse Valley, surrounded by numerous blooming orchids. The birthplace of France's national heroine is also nearby. The massive basilica was built from pink granite from the Vosges Mountains! Bronzes of Joan of Arc and her family stand in the forecourt of the basilica.

Joan of Arc's birthplace dates back to the 15th century and is now a listed building. Right next door is the new "Faces of Joan" presentation center, redesigned in 2020. Here, you can experience a detailed tour that paints a comprehensive picture of Joan—from her childhood in Domrémy to current adaptations of her story.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I explore in Gondrecourt-Le-Château itself?

In Gondrecourt-Le-Château, you can visit the remnants of the historic Château de Gondrecourt-le-Château, including the significant Round Tower (Tour Ronde). This medieval tower, once a prison, now houses the Musée Lorrain du Cheval, showcasing the historical role of horses. The town's church is also recognized as a historical monument.

Are there any attractions related to Joan of Arc near Gondrecourt-Le-Château?

Yes, several significant sites related to Joan of Arc are nearby. You can visit the Birthplace of Joan of Arc in Domrémy-la-Pucelle, a 15th-century house authenticated as her childhood home. Also in Domrémy-la-Pucelle is the beautiful Saint-Remy Church, where Joan of Arc was baptized. Overlooking the valley, the Bois-Chenu Basilica, built near where she heard her voices, offers breathtaking views of the Meuse river's meanders.

What natural features can I discover around Gondrecourt-Le-Château?

The Ornain River flows through Gondrecourt-Le-Château, with quays lining its banks. The surrounding Forêts de Gondrecourt-le-Château are a Natura 2000 site, important for their ecological value. Additionally, La Blanche Côte, a crescent-shaped hill peaking at 350 meters, offers particular wildlife and plants and is a popular spot for paragliding and hang-gliding.

Where can I learn about the local water heritage in Gondrecourt-Le-Château?

You can explore the 'Circuit original autour de la découverte du patrimoine lié à l'eau'. This marked path, approximately 2km long, starts from the Carpière and guides you through the lower and upper towns, highlighting the area's water heritage.

Are there any unique cultural experiences in the area?

Beyond the historical sites, the Musée Lorrain du Cheval in the Round Tower offers a unique cultural insight into the historical significance of horses in civil, military, and agricultural contexts, along with associated trades.
